1. Communicate with Compassion: In the wake of a tragedy, clear and compassionate communication is key. It is important to keep employees, customers, and stakeholders informed about what has happened and how the business plans to move forward. Providing support and resources for those affected by the tragedy can help foster a sense of unity and resilience within the organization. 2. Seek Professional Guidance: Dealing with the aftermath of a tragedy can be overwhelming, and it may be beneficial to seek the guidance of professionals such as counselors, therapists, or legal advisors. These experts can provide valuable support and advice on how to navigate the complexities of closure and finishing strategies during such a difficult time. 3. Review Financial Obligations: When considering business closure after a tragedy, it is crucial to review and fulfill any financial obligations, such as paying employees, vendors, and creditors. This can help ensure that the business closes in a responsible and ethical manner, preserving its reputation and relationships within the community. 4. Develop a Closure Plan: Creating a comprehensive closure plan can help guide the business through the process of finishing operations in an orderly fashion. This plan should outline key steps such as notifying clients and customers, wrapping up projects, and transitioning responsibilities to other employees or partners. 5. Focus on Healing and Recovery: While it is important to address the practical aspects of business closure and finishing after a tragedy, it is equally important to prioritize the well-being and healing of those affected. Providing emotional support, organizing memorial services, and fostering a sense of community can help individuals cope with their grief and begin the process of recovery. In conclusion, navigating business closure and finishing strategies in the aftermath of a ceremony tragedy requires a delicate balance of compassion, professionalism, and resilience. By communicating effectively, seeking expert guidance, fulfilling financial obligations, developing a closure plan, and prioritizing healing and recovery, businesses can honor the memory of the tragedy while moving forward with strength and solidarity.
